Ride the Historic Funiculars: A Unique Perspective

One of the most iconic Valparaíso Experiences is undoubtedly riding its historic funiculars, also known as ascensores. These charming, vintage cable cars offer not just transportation, but also a unique and memorable way to ascend the city’s steep hills, called cerros. As you glide upwards, you’re treated to breathtaking panoramic views of the colorful cityscape, the bustling port, and the vast Pacific Ocean. These funiculars are more than just a mode of transport; they are a vital part of Valparaíso’s cultural heritage and a testament to its innovative urban planning from the late 19th and early 20th centuries. In fact, several of these ascensores have been declared historical monuments, highlighting their significance. Therefore, riding them is essential to truly understand the city.

A Journey Through Time

Each funicular has its own unique character and history, reflecting the distinct personalities of the cerros they serve. For example, the Ascensor Reina Victoria offers stunning views of the port, while the Ascensor Concepción connects the lower part of the city with one of Valparaíso’s most vibrant neighborhoods. Moreover, the ride itself is an experience. As the wooden cars creak and climb, you’re transported back in time, gaining a glimpse into the daily lives of past residents. Furthermore, the upper stations often lead to hidden plazas, charming cafes, and local artisan shops, making each funicular ride an adventure in itself. Must-Try Dishes in Valparaíso

Among the must-try dishes are empanadas, savory pastries filled with meat, cheese, or seafood; ceviche, a refreshing dish of raw fish marinated in citrus juices; and cazuela, a traditional Chilean stew packed with vegetables and meat. For seafood lovers, the fresh catches of the day are prepared in numerous ways, each highlighting the natural flavors of the ocean. Additionally, don’t miss the opportunity to try completo, a Chilean-style hot dog loaded with toppings, which is a popular street food. Visit La Sebastiana: Neruda’s Coastal Retreat

Visiting La Sebastiana, one of Pablo Neruda’s three homes in Chile, is undoubtedly one of the most enriching Valparaíso Experiences. Perched atop one of Valparaíso’s many hills, this house offers a fascinating glimpse into the life and mind of the Nobel Prize-winning poet. As you explore the multi-level residence, you’ll discover Neruda’s eclectic collections, including maritime artifacts, antique furniture, and original artwork. Moreover, the house itself is a testament to Neruda’s unique architectural vision, reflecting his love for the sea and the bohemian spirit of Valparaíso.

Exploring the Unique Architecture and Collections

La Sebastiana stands out due to its quirky design and panoramic views. Neruda collaborated with architects to create a space that felt both intimate and expansive, filled with natural light and offering stunning vistas of the Pacific Ocean. Therefore, each room is filled with curiosities that Neruda collected throughout his life, providing insight into his creative process and personal passions. Furthermore, the house’s layout encourages exploration, with winding staircases and hidden nooks that add to its charm. Visiting La Sebastiana is truly one of the best Valparaíso Attractions.
